Game Title: Anno 1701
Your name: Pieter Dirk Greeuw
Pretty or ugly: Ugly
Description: Whenever a "disaster" occurs in the game a loud overwhelming sound plays even if the disaster doesn't threaten you directly. When the disaster is no longer on your screen the sound fades away but as soon as you go near it with your FoV you hear the sound again. Also it plays so loud you can hardly hear the other sounds that effect you directly. .

Game Title: Oblivion IV
Your name: Pieter Dirk Greeuw
Pretty or ugly: Pretty
Description: The sound you hear in the game tells you what is going on around. When the game is in a normal state you hear only the background music, when you are in danger or close by an enemy it switches to a completely different sound to make you aware of it. If you lvl up or raise a skill a small sound makes you aware of it even when you are busy fighting or doing something else. .

Game Title: Freelancer
Your name: Tim Hengeveld
Pretty or ugly: Ugly
Description: This is more a case of bad audio DESIGN than bad audio per sé. In Freelancer you can travel from planet to planet, and enter bars to find quests. These bars are usually populated by 4 or 5 questgivers, who represent different factions.
The problem is that they all say the same thing over and over again, often even using the same sound file, making everyone sound the same – even on just one planet, let alone the other 20. The above is a recording of a particularly bad spree where the main character even utters the exact same randomly triggered response to the same questions three times in a row. .

Game Title: Mafia
Your name: Tim Hengeveld
Pretty or ugly: Pretty
Description: Mafia is a game that pays a lot of attention to atmosphere. Everything is very authentic, and audio plays an important role in it. As you traverse the city, you will hear various classic '30s jazz songs that really enhance the mood.
Each district has it's own distinct tune (such as the song 'Chinatown my Chinatown' playing in Chinatown), and these songs seamlessly flow together as you're driving around. They are not bound to your car radio like in GTA, but persist even when you're on foot.
Aside from that, the ambient sounds, voice acting and sound effects are also top-notch. The sound of seagulls and waves when you get close to the ocean, the sound of the clutch as you're driving around – it all fits perfectly. .
